In Light of Women, is a collection and commentary comprising 72 pages of contemporary icon painting done in egg tempera. An exploration of women in iconography, the absence of their voices in the church and icon imagery. Exquisitely painted icons are juxtaposed with text describing each of the images history, religious context and reflections about the world we live in today. Mary Jane Miller’s In Light of Women, One Woman’s Journey with Contemporary iconography is a provocative addition to the growing body of work (both image and text). Her images extend the reach of the icon beyond the boundaries of the Orthodox tradition. Following a brief introduction to the history of the icon, and a lyrical meditation on the properties of the earth pigments and egg yolk that she mixes to create her colors. This collection was created by a women iconographer in Mexico. She offers a selection of her icons arranged in three chapters: Mary Icons – The Most Popular through the Ages; The Gospel of Mary Magdalene – Icons Inspired by the Gnostic Text and Creative Insights and Image from Traditional Theology; and Feminine Voice – Classic Icons Interpreted with the Focus on Women. Each icon is accompanied by Miller’s reflections, short essays that fuse theological with personal ruminations. Where are the women in History? Miller is challenging the list in Women iconographers. She is a women iconographer and conveys her feminist arguments with passion and ingenuity, offering a critique of the position of women in the historical church. Her Byzantine style iconography visually echoes many of the arguments of feminist theologians and biblical critics of today.
